So can I have my computer fully shutdown and it will still harvest? when using delegated harvasting. let me know please. thanks in advance.

Yes if you use delegated harvesting on another computer you can shut down your computer.

This is a tricky answer. lol
So what if I'm only using 1 computer..
Because you said "If I use delegated harvesting on ANOTHER computer" you mean who ever picked up my delegated harvesting for me? sorry just a little confused.

When youīre using delegated harvesting, the Supernodes do the harvesting for you. So your Computer must not run.

Everytime I turn the computer and then log in to my wallet again I had to start my delegated harvesting again. I thought it would still be on. can you correct me if im wrong. Thanks


You need to switch to remote node ip. Pick from this list http://nodeexplorer.com/ and when you open your wallet first in setting tab change ip from 127.0.0.1 to ip that you chose from http://nodeexplorer.com/

Save settings and then run delegated harvesting.
